[quote=Anonymous] I bought a $4500 violin and bow for my child after many years of renting muffled cheapies. It has a very big sound and can project across a concert hall, which came in useful when she had a solo at the Strathmore Music Center. I did not buy the $9000, better-sounding one, because she's still in fractional sizes and she's going to outgrow it in a few years. My point is, you get what you pay for usually, so whether it's to prevent injury or allow for better performance, it's always a good idea to buy the best equipment you can afford. [/quote]
